NOTICE
Danger of corrosion in the cooling water circuit! When selecting the recirculating chiller
make sure that no base metals are used in components carrying water. Base metals also
increase the conductivity of the cooling water.
The system must be filled with cooling water that has been mixed with a cooling water
additive to be obtained from Analytik Jena AG. The preparation of the cooling water has
been described in the section "Maintenance of the recirculating chiller" p. 68. The cool-
ant additive prevents damage to the PlasmaQuant PQ 9000 potentially resulting from
corrosion and biological contamination. Damage to the device due to operation without
coolant additive is excluded from the warranty!
For night-time and constant operation the recirculating chiller can be controlled via the
PlasmaQuant PQ 9000. Analytik Jena AG supplies a matching communication cable with
the recirculating chiller. The cable connects the RS 232 connection "Chiller remote" on
the left-hand side of the PlasmaQuant PQ 9000 (6 in Figure 10 p. 29) to the interface
on the right-hand side of the chiller. The chiller is then switched on and off automati-
cally as the plasma ignites and goes out.
4.1.6
Device layout and space requirements
The PlasmaQuant PQ 9000 is a compact device conceived for table-top operation. The
space required is a function of all components needed for the measurement.
The autosampler is installed next to the base instrument. Additional space may be re-
quired for a PC and possibly a printer. The PC and printer may also be placed on a sepa-
rate table.
The workbench must meet the following requirements:
The dimensions of the workbench for the PlasmaQuant PQ 9000 and the au-
tosampler must be at least 1800 mm x 750 mm. For unimpeded access to the supply
and control connections leave a minimum distance of 30 cm between the rear side of
the PlasmaQuant PQ 9000 and the next wall or use a heavy lift roll-top table. The
height should be chosen according to ergonomic aspects.
The workbench must be capable of bearing a load of at least 200 kg.
The workbench surface must be wipe, scrape and corrosion resistant and must not
absorb moisture.
The workbench must be freely accessible from all sides.
For unimpeded cooling air circulation and effective cooling, the surfaces of the housing
sides of the water-air cooler require a minimum distance of 60 cm from adjacent ob-
jects. Due to the dissipated heat from the recirculating chiller and possible noise it
should be placed outside the laboratory. An extension of the cooling water tubes is per-
mitted if the minimum pressure and the flow volume are maintained.
A 2-litre polyethylene laboratory bottle with a screw cap is recommended as a waste
bottle.
